When looking for used welfare vans for sale, there are a few key factors to keep in mind to ensure you make a smart investment. Whether you are purchasing a van for your business or organization, it is important to thoroughly research and inspect potential vehicles to find one that fits your needs and budget. Here are some tips for buying used welfare vans for sale:
1. Determine Your Needs: Before you start looking at used welfare vans for sale, it is important to determine your specific needs. Consider the number of passengers you will need to transport, as well as the types of amenities and features that are important to you. For example, if you will be using the van to transport elderly or disabled individuals, you may need a van with wheelchair accessibility features. Make a list of your requirements to help narrow down your options.
2. Set a Budget: It is also important to establish a budget before shopping for used welfare vans for sale. Determine how much you are willing to spend on a van, as well as any additional costs for maintenance, repairs, and insurance. Keep in mind that while buying a used van may be more affordable upfront, you may incur more costs in the long run for upkeep and repairs.
3. Research Different Models: Take the time to research different models of welfare vans to find one that fits your needs and budget. Look for vans that are reliable, durable, and have good safety ratings. Check online reviews and ratings from other buyers to get a sense of the overall quality of the van. Consider factors such as fuel efficiency, cargo space, and comfort features when comparing different models.
4. Inspect the Van: Before purchasing a used welfare van, it is essential to thoroughly inspect the vehicle to ensure it is in good condition. Check the exterior for any signs of damage or rust, and look for any dents or scratches that may indicate previous accidents. Inspect the interior for cleanliness, comfort, and functionality. Test drive the van to check for any unusual noises or performance issues.
5. Check the Maintenance Records: When buying a used welfare van, it is helpful to review the vehicle’s maintenance records to get an idea of its service history. Look for records of routine maintenance, repairs, and any major work that has been done on the van. This information can give you an idea of how well the van has been cared for and whether any significant repairs may be needed in the future.
6. Consider Buying from a Reputable Dealer: While you may be able to find a good deal on a used welfare van from a private seller, buying from a reputable dealer can offer additional benefits. Dealers often have a wider selection of vans to choose from, as well as access to financing options and warranties. Additionally, dealers may offer certified pre-owned vans that have undergone thorough inspections and come with extended warranties for added peace of mind.
7. Negotiate the Price: When buying a used welfare van, don’t be afraid to negotiate the price with the seller. Use your research on the van’s value and condition to make a fair offer that reflects its worth. Be prepared to walk away if the seller is not willing to negotiate or if the price is higher than your budget allows. Remember that it is always possible to find another van that meets your needs at a better price.
